Mesothelioma Lawsuits

If you or someone close to you has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, you may be qualified for compensation. Families may sue asbestos companies for causing this disease.

Compensation often includes money for treatment costs, lost wages and documented expenses. But, it also covers noneconomic damages such as pain and suffering and punitive damages.

Settlements

A settlement in a mesothelioma lawsuit is an agreement between the victim or their family members and the defendant who pays compensation for the victim's damages. It usually is determined by the victim's prior and expected future medical expenses, lost wages, and other costs that are documented as a result of their diagnosis. It could also cover non-economic injuries, such as pain and discomfort.

The average settlement for mesothelioma is greater than $1 million. The financial compensation is intended to aid families and victims through this difficult time. Asbestos lawyers work hard to obtain the best settlement possible for their clients.

It could take years for mesothelioma cases to be settled and, in some cases, even be litigated. This is due to the volume of evidence that needs to be gathered and analysed as well as the number of defendants involved in the case. Mesothelioma lawyers are well-versed in this type of litigation, and can make it as straightforward as they can for their clients.

Settlements for mesothelioma will help victims pay for medical treatment, funeral costs and living expenses. Patients who have mesothelioma could also be compensated for their emotional suffering and loss of income. Certain types of compensation for mesothelioma can be taxed. IRS does not tax compensation for personal injury cases. However, money that is awarded as punitive damages or interest on a settlement can be taxed.

Trials

In addition to compensating victims for their loss, a mesothelioma lawsuit can also hold asbestos companies accountable. Depending on how the case is handled, the victims could receive compensation from settlements, verdicts and trust funds.

If a settlement is reached or the case goes to trial the parties will exchange information with one another during the process of discovery. Depositions involve the examination of witnesses by the attorneys of both sides. Attorneys will scrutinize the medical records to determine which companies are responsible.

The type of mesothelioma the victim has and the severity of their illness will determine how much they might get from a settlement or verdict. Compensation is usually divided into two types: economic and noneconomic damages. The latter category includes tangible expenses like treatment costs as well as documented lost wages and pain and suffering.

A verdict at trial could be more profitable than a settlement, however trials are time-consuming and the result of a trial can't be guaranteed. Appeal proceedings can also delay the payment of any award. Additionally, a jury's decision might not be accepted by the court. This could result in the plaintiff not receiving compensation for a long time after the verdict.

Contingency fees

Many families worry that filing mesothelioma lawsuits will cost a lot. However, the majority of lawyers operate on a contingency fee. They only get paid if the case is won. This can save your family money during the lengthy legal process that can take years. Mesothelioma attorneys usually charge a percentage of the settlement or compensation they obtain for you. However, this does not include court or client fees. Client costs vary by law firm, and are usually defined in your attorney's fee agreement.

Many asbestos victims don't even realize they have a right to compensation until they are diagnosed with mesothelioma. Once a diagnosis is received it is essential to act swiftly. It is crucial to act quickly due to time constraints (known as statutes or limitations) which must be met before an action can be filed. It also takes time to investigate and prepare the case for trial. It is therefore important to hire a mesothelioma attorney with years of experience.
